Travelling through life
Damon is a traveller trying to find connection and meaning - through places and people.
The story consists of dreamlike reminiscences on opportunity and regret that flicker between first person and third person narrative as if to ask the question, did this really happen? Like his compatriot Coetzee, his writing suggests a kind of selectively embellished autobiography.
Galgut describes events, and their fallout, in a way that lingers with the reader. by Jeremy
